RICHARD SEPULVEDA, Plaintiff, v. RSM ORIENTAL FOOD MART & RESTAURANT, LLC, et al., Defendants.


ORDER TO SHOW CAUSE

KANDIS A. WESTMORE UNITED STATES MAGISTRATE JUDGE

Plaintiff Richard Sepulveda filed the instant suit against Defendants RSM Oriental Food Mart & Restaurant, LLC, et al. (Dkt. No. 1.) Pursuant to General Order 56, the joint site inspection deadline was August 1, 2023, and Plaintiff was required to file a "Notice of Need for Mediation" forty-two days after the joint site inspection. (See Dkt. No. Re: Dkt. No. 4.) Thus, Plaintiff's "Notice of Need for Mediation" was due by September 12, 2023.

As of the date of this order, Plaintiff has yet to file his "Notice of Need for Mediation." Plaintiff is therefore ordered to show cause by November 10, 2023, why this case should not be dismissed for failure to prosecute by filing the Notice of Need for Mediation or a request to extend the filing deadline.

IT IS SO ORDERED.
